Isaiah 66 closes the book with a stunning courtroom scene. Heaven is God's throne, earth his footstool — no temple can contain him. Yet he looks with favor on the humble and contrite. The chapter pivots sharply: God rejects empty worship while promising restoration for Jerusalem.
